Indulge in the rich, Mediterranean-inspired flavors of this Greek Yogurt Cake with Raisin Syrup—a beautifully moist dessert that strikes the perfect balance between tangy and sweet. Made with fluffy full-fat Greek yogurt, this cake offers a tender crumb while keeping things light and airy, thanks to a perfectly executed blend of baking essentials. What elevates this recipe is the luxurious raisin syrup, a warm mixture of honey, lemon juice, cinnamon, and plump raisins simmered to perfection. Drizzle the syrup generously over each slice for a burst of sweetness and a hint of spice in every bite.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F). Grease and flour a round 23-cm (9-inch) cake pan or line it with parchment paper.
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
In a mixing bowl, cream the softened butter and sugar together until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es using a hand or stand mixer.
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the vanilla extract.
With the mixer on low, alternate adding the dry ingredients and the Greek yogurt to the wet ingredients, starting and ending with the dry mixture. Mix until just combined.
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
Bake for 35-40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Remove from the oven and let it c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
While the cake cools, prepare the raisin syrup. In a small saucepan, combine the raisins, water, honey, lemon juice, and ground cinnamon.
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for 10-12 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the syrup thickens slightly. Remove from heat and let it cool to room temperature.
Once the cake is cool, slice into portions and drizzle the raisin syrup generously over each slice before serving. Optionally, garnish with a dollop of Greek yogurt or a sprinkle of powdered sugar.
